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6075 0818555013 96159494
7840332 73915516662
7840332 73915516662
335 3200152064 282 283 5622937
All about undefined
Interested in learning more?
7840332 73915516662
335 3200152064 282 283 5622937
See more
720523 5625 392
23 4197282039 3107497 11741
See more
76745299803 261
20 957385 5080541 4438
See more